Road reopens

The main road adjoining the Sri Dalada Maligawa, which remained closed for several years, will be opened for traffic at the auspicious time of 9.37 a.m. today.

The government has decided to re-open the road after an intelligence review concluded that there is no security threat to the Sri Dalada Maligawa at present. Central Region Development Minister Tissa Attanayake played a key role in getting the authorities to reopen the road. The road was barricaded and closed for all traffic after the bomb explosion near the Dalada Maligawa in January 1998.

The road will now be open in a two-way configuration for all light vehicles. This is expected to reduce traffic congestion in Kandy.
